What is the Compound Interest ?

The interest you earn each year is added to your principal, so that the balance doesn't merely grow, it grows at an increasing rate.

What is Principal Amount ?

The amount which you have invested.

What is Interest Rate ?

An interest rate is the cost of borrowing money, or conversely, the income earned from lending money. Interest rates are expressed as percentage of the principal per period.

What is No. of Years ?

Period in which you have invested.

What is Frequency?

The number of compounding periods in one year.

Compound Interest Formula

Here is the formula for finding the compound interest

A = P (1 + r/n) nt

  • A = value after t periods
  • P = principal amount (initial investment)
  • r = annual interest rate
  • n = number of times the interest is compounded per year
  • t = number of years the money is borrowed for / money is invested for

Compound Interest Example

John has invested 1,00,000 at compound interest rate of 10% for 5 Years where interest compounded yearly with principal

  • P (Principal Amount) = 1,00,000
  • r (Rate Of Interest) = 10 %
  • n (Compund Frequency) = 1
  • t (Period) = 5 Year
Compound Interest Calculation Steps

  • A = P (1 + r/n) nt
  • A = 1,00,000 (1 + 10 / (100 * 1))1 * 5
  • A = 1,00,000 (1 + 10 / 100)5
  • A = 1,00,000 (1 + 0.1)5
  • A = 1,00,000 (1.1)5
  • A = 1,00,000 (1.61051)5
  • A = 1,61,051
